What Is the Bulgarian Premium Aged Rakia, Cold Cuts and Pickles Tasting?

Bulgarian Premium Aged Rakia, Cold Cuts and Pickles Tasting - What Is the Bulgarian Premium Aged Rakia, Cold Cuts and Pickles Tasting?

This is a curated tasting event in Sofia, designed to introduce you to Bulgaria’s traditional spirits and snacks. Hosted at a secret location close to Serdika metro station, the event offers a chance to sample five small glasses of aged rakia—each carefully selected to showcase different flavors and qualities.

The experience is more than just drinking; it’s about understanding the art of making rakia and preserving Bulgaria’s culinary traditions through stories and pairing techniques. Alongside the spirits, you’ll enjoy a selection of cold cuts, cheeses, and pickles, all chosen to complement the rakia and enhance the tasting.

The setting is quite stylish, with a vintage vibe that transports you away from the city’s hustle into an aristocratic, almost nostalgic atmosphere. During your hour, your guide will share fascinating insights into how rakia is produced, the history of pickling in Bulgaria, and why these flavors are so central to the local identity.

The Itinerary Breakdown

Start at: The tasting begins at ul. “Tsar Shishman” 41, where you’ll receive instructions on how to find the secret venue.

Main event: You’ll settle into the elegant, vintage ambiance and begin tasting five different aged rakia spirits. Each shot offers a unique flavor profile—ranging from smooth and mellow to more intense and aromatic. Alongside, enjoy an array of cold cuts, cheeses, and traditional pickles that are perfectly paired to bring out the best in each sip.

Listening and learning: Throughout the experience, your guide shares captivating stories about the history of rakia, pickling traditions, and Bulgarian flavors. These stories add depth and context, turning a simple tasting into a cultural journey.

End point: The experience wraps up back at the starting location, making the whole event compact but fulfilling.
